Praise Is Your Weapon When Everything Shakes
I will say of the Lord, 'He is my refuge and my fortress; My God, in Him I will trust.
— Ps. 91:2
When things get shaky the instinct is to scan around for whoever can fix it. Some person, some system, somebody in charge. You already belong to a different kingdom than the one that is wobbling.
Colossians 1:13 says God "hath delivered us from the power of darkness, and hath translated us into the kingdom of his dear Son." Delivered and translated. Past tense, already done, nothing to reapply for.
And His promises do not stall. Hebrews 6:14 says, "Surely blessing I will bless thee, and multiplying I will multiply thee." That is not a maybe. God said it over Abraham, and He does not do half commitments.
So what do you actually do when the ground moves? You praise. Psalm 18:3 says, "I will call upon the Lord, who is worthy to be praised: so shall I be saved from mine enemies." Praise is not you performing for God, it is you remembering out loud what is already true.
Psalm 103:1 says, "Bless the Lord, O my soul: and all that is within me, bless his holy name." A few verses later it describes Him as the one "Who redeemeth thy life from destruction; who crowneth thee with lovingkindness and tender mercies." You do the remembering. The Holy Spirit does the lifting.
Psalm 91:2 says, "I will say of the Lord, He is my refuge and my fortress: my God; in him will I trust." Notice the words I will say. Your mouth gets to agree with God before your circumstances catch up.
